         <title>Job Description and Responsibilities </title>
         <author>pweaver18</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/pweaver18/5qqju20j3a9h/wish/235911858</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Radiological technician<br>Take X-rays and CT scans or administer non radioactive materials into patients blood stream for diagnostic purposes.<br>A typical work day would be spent mostly in a hospital or physical training facility. You will have to be an active listener, you will need to know how to speak to people and  be able to write certain things down. You need to have problem sensitivity and oral expression. </div>]]></description>

         <title>Working Conditions </title>
         <author>pweaver18</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/pweaver18/5qqju20j3a9h/wish/235916423</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>To be a radiologic technician you will need to be prepared for illnesses and infectious diseases. There will be 40 hours a week on a normal basis. There could be times where you will have to work nights and weekends but sometimes you won't have to. There will be a team but you will need to work alone while doing the job unless you need help with something. This job will be emotionally demanding in some certain scenarios. This is an inside walking around job. </div>]]></description>

         <title>Local Earnings and Benefits</title>
         <author>pweaver18</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/pweaver18/5qqju20j3a9h/wish/235926722</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>You will expect to get paid about $53,000 in Pa. You would get paid yearly and the benefits include sick leave and maternity leave, also you receive health, life and disability insurance. </div>]]></description>
